Maths learning this weekπ’
Reception have also been learning how to make the numbers 6, 7 and 8. The children used the partβwhole model to find different ways to compose each number and practised saying stem sentences such as: β3 is a part and 3 is a part, the whole is 6.β

This week in maths, Reception have been learning about pairs. We talked about how a pair means two and used objects to find matching pairs.
We explored this using socks, finding pairs that matched and spotting odd socks when there was only one. This helped us understand the difference between odd numbers (one left over) and even numbers (all socks have a pair). Great learning and lots of fun had by everyone!ππ§¦

Our Reception children have been putting their phonics knowledge into action today. Using our wooden log letters, they practised segmenting and blending to spell a range of CVC words. Well done Reception!πππΌ
